Services set for White County accident victims

By Dean Dyer WRWH Radio
Posted 10:24PM on Monday 16th March 2015 ( 9 years ago )
CLEVELAND - Funeral services have been scheduled for Wednesday for the two White County teens who died when their car plunged into Town Creek over the weekend.

White County Deputy Coroner Josh Barrett said 18-year-old Taylor Scott Swing and 16-year-old Cecily Hamilton, both of Cleveland drowned, after the vehicle they were in plunged off an embankment and overturned in the creek.

Services for Swing have been set for 2 p.m. Wednesday at the chapel of Barrett Funeral Home. Visitation will be held from 2-4 and 6-8 p.m. Tuesday.

Services for Hamilton will be held at 4:30 p.m. Wednesday at Memorial Park Funeral Home in Gainesville. Visitation will be held from 5-9 p.m. Tuesday.

Meanwhile, a Taylor Swing Memorial Fund has been set up at United Community Bank in Cleveland to help defray his funeral expenses for the family.
